Contingency Fees

The majority of mesothelioma lawyers are paid on a contingency basis. This means that they receive a portion of the amount that is paid to the plaintiff or his family. This arrangement might appear risky, but it enables patients to receive more money for their treatment. Mesothelioma is a rare form of cancer that affects the mesothelium, or the lining that surrounds organs and body cavities. The cancer is caused by asbestos exposure, which was used in many buildings and insulation products. The symptoms typically begin in the chest wall, lungs or the heart. However, they may spread to any body part. The most frequent mesothelioma type is called mesothelioma that is pleural and occurs in the lung. Another type is peritoneal mesothelioma, where the lining of the abdomen thickens.
